Analysis of the cases filed against Shri Developers, where the builder lost, revealed significant information regarding their compliance with the Real Estate (Regulation and Development) Act, 2016 (RERA). The cases highlighted a recurring theme surrounding violations of Section 11(2) of the RERA, which mandates that builders must indicate their RERA registration number and website in advertisements and prospectuses for their projects.
The primary reason for the disputes in these cases was the builder's failure to adhere to this regulatory requirement. Although the builder claimed that the violations were not willful and accepted the flaws in their advertisements, the Authority ruled against them, imposing fines of Rs. 1,25,000/- in each case. This pattern suggests that one of the most common triggers for litigation involving Shri Developers stems from their inability to comply fully with RERA guidelines, particularly concerning project advertising.
